A 500 internal server error general indicates something wrong with server configuration or the request itself that either way the server can’t process. ExpressionEngine wouldn’t have anything to log here, because whatever error is happening is probably before ExpressionEngine is even instantiated. Check your web server error logs, you should have more information there.

Origin Media if you’re only getting it on the homepage, I suspect it may be related to external calls being made via curl. Let me know when you get access to the Apache error log, it should have a pretty specific error if that’s the case.
